Corporate Tax Rate Debate in Congress Focused on Apple

Corporate income taxes came under fire this week as a Senate panel questioned Apple CEO Tim Cook over the company's avoidance of taxes on profits earned overseas. The hearing by the Senate Permanent Subcommittee on Investigations came on the heels of a May 21, 2013 Senate report outlining how multinational companies shelter international profits from US taxation.
